The Electrifying Demise by: James Munson & Joy Munson

Monmouth County, New Jersey Jun 22, 2020 (Issuewire.com)  - The Electrifying Demise is a remarkable story of Mike when his life changes one day when he witnessed a situation involving a grandfather who has hired a pilot to fly his ailing granddaughter to a hospital.   

The pilot is too inebriated to fly the plane and Mike overhears his frustration. Mike explains his abilities as a pilot to the grandfather and the decision for Mike to fly the child to a  hospital is an on the spot decision.

The many characters in the story are interesting,  memorable and some exciting moments evolve in confrontations for  Mike along the way. There are romantic moments that happen as well as reverence,  politics, hardships, criminal justice and philanthropy on a large scale.

The title of the book is reflected near the end when justice is displayed. Jim was a carpenter, salesman, lay preacher and high school shop teacher. While Joy was employed as a secretary for attorneys; bookkeeper for 1st husband’s painting business and mother of their 4 children; Campbell Soup inventory control clerk; and retired from Western Electric (now AT&T) as data processing associate.
